240 发简信
IP属地:上海
  • Resize,w 360,h 240
    Flutter热重载

    工作原理 热重载是指,在不中断 App 正常运行的情况下,动态注入修改后的代码片段。而这一切的背后,离不开 Flutter 所提供的运行时编译能...

  • Resize,w 360,h 240
    Flutter之原理解析

    Flutter之原理解析 Flutter 是 Google推出并开源的移动应用开发框架,主打 跨平台、高保真、高性能。开发者可以通过 Dart语...

  • Resize,w 360,h 240
    Objective-C的内存布局

    Objective-C的内存布局 在Objective-C中任何的类定义都是对象。即在程序启动的时候任何类定义都对应一块内存。在编译的时候,编译...

  • load与initialize对比

    load +load方法会在runtime加载类、分类时调用 每个类、分类的+load,在程序运行过程中只调用一次 调用顺序: 3.1 先调用类...

  • 关系型数据库和非关系型数据库

    1. 关系型 关系型数据库的表是二维表,结构稳定,修改不易。经常需要联表查询。优点 1.询能力高,可以操作很复杂的查询一致性高。由于并发高,在数...

  • NSString、NSArray、Block使用Copy

    1. @propery声明NSString、NSArray、NSDictionary时使用copy 因为 NSString、NSArray、N...

  • Resize,w 360,h 240
    iOS概念知识

    面向对象的三大特征,并作简单的介绍。 面向对象的三个基本特征是:封装、继承、多态。 1.封装是面向对象的特征之一, 是对象和类概念的主要特性。 ...

    0.1 1420 0 6 1
  • iOS与JS 交互的问题

    最近由于项目的需求,加入了部分html5的页面,因此本地代码和H5之间有很多交互的部分。在网上查阅资料发现主要有两种: 1,拦截协议,即通过监听...

  • Masonry/SnapKit 约束scrollView的问题

    最近做项目,在用Masonry ,约束好了scrollView,但是就是不能滑动。参考网上的方法,解决了。